The Turandot and Marco Polo programmes

The number of Chinese students taking part in the Marco Polo and Turandot programmes has doubled since 2009, increasing from 1,099 to 2,178, as was illustrated at the Conference held at the Farnesina on 15 December. Switzerland – “Invest in Italy Roadshow”

On 11 December 2017 the “Invest in Italy Roadshow” organised by the Italian Embassy was held at ETH Zurich, in association with the Berne office of the Italian Trade Agency (ICE), the Italian Chamber of Commerce for Switzerland, and the support of the Swiss Chamber of Commerce in Italy. Italy and the Latin American Continent meet at the Farnesina

On 13 December the Farnesina will host the 8th Italy-Latin American and Carribean Conference, which is part of the fiftieth anniversary celebrations of the establishment of the Italy-Latin  America Institute (IILA). Sudan – An intercultural communication manual is developed between Italians and Sudanese

An intercultural communication manual between Italians and Sudanese has been set up which is aimed at business people, tourists, NGOs and members of public institutions.
